Factors associated with conditional weight evolution among preschool children enrolled in day care centers of the seventh sanitary district of a capital of northeastern Brazil, 2014 (n=320).
| Characteristics | Reference | β* | 95%CI | p-value |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Prenatal | <6 appointments | 0.36 | 0.13–0.60 | 0.003 |
| Rooming-in Care | No | 0.30 | 0.03–0.58 | 0.032 |
| Breastfed | Never | 0.44 | 0.06–0.81 | 0.022 |
*multiple linear regression model adjusted for per capita income below the extreme poverty line, maternal age at birth, and height at the time of the survey; 95%CI: 95% confidence interval.
